The Role

We're looking for a proactive and organised Marketing Lead to join our growing marketing team. This person will play a key role in supporting campaign execution, reporting, design coordination, and day-to-day marketing operations. You'll be working closely with the Head of Marketing and wider team to ensure our channels are running smoothly and delivering impact.

Key Responsibilities
  • Campaign Support & Ownership
    • Assist in planning, launching, and monitoring marketing campaigns across email, social, direct mail, and digital channels
    • Coordinate timelines, assets, and stakeholder input to keep campaigns on track
    • Own campaigns end-to-end with support from the team, measuring the success and providing recommendations
  • Reporting & Insights
    • Compile and maintain regular performance reports across channels to provide to the HoM and wider business
    • Help interpret data to identify trends, opportunities, and areas for improvement
    • Support ad-hoc reporting requests from the team
  • Design & Creative Coordination
    • Liaise with designers and external partners to brief and manage creative assets
    • Ensure brand consistency across all materials
    • Assist with light design tasks (e.g. Canva or similar tools)
  • Team & Channel Support
    • Respond to ad-hoc queries from the marketing team and wider business
    • Help maintain marketing systems, tools, and documentation
    • Support with content uploads, scheduling, and basic web updates
    • Assist with marketing spend budget management
What We're Looking For
  • Strong organisational skills and attention to detail
  • Comfortable working across multiple projects and deadlines
  • Good communication and collaboration skills
  • Familiarity with marketing tools (e.g. HubSpot, Canva, Google Analytics, LinkedIn)
  • A proactive mindset and willingness to learn
